External Flow Sensor and Cable
Intended Use:
The Philips Respironics External Flow Sensor is intended for use with Trilogy Evo Universal-series ventilators. It measures the gas (air, oxygen or
carbon dioxide) flow rate in the airway from the patient circuit to the patient's lung during inhalation and exhalation. One side of the sensor device
is attached to the patient circuit while the other side is connected to the ventilator.
Two sizes of this sensor are included in the case: adult/pediatric, and pediatric/infant.
To use the sensor, follow the instructions provided with the sensor. To connect the external flow sensor to Trilogy Evo Universal, see Figure 1 and
Figure 2.

Filters

Air-inlet foam filter
The air-inlet foam filter protects Trilogy Evo Universal from dirt and dust. This filter is for single patient use. For instructions on rinsing the filter, see
the "Cleaning and Disinfection" chapter. For instructions on replacing the filter, see the "Service and Maintenance" chapter.
Particulate filter
The particulate filter protects Trilogy Evo Universal from fine particulates. This filter is for single patient use. For instructions on replacing the filter,
see the "Service and Maintenance" chapter.
CBRN filter adapter
Use the CBRN filter adapter when using a CBRN filter in place of the disposable inlet filter. For instructions on installing the filter adapter, see the
"Device Setup" chapter.
